We are a group of parents whose children attend Northern School for Autism (NSA)- Lalor Campus. Our mission is to obtain commitment from The Department of Education and James Merlino to allocate funding asap to build a Secondary Campus.
Our Lalor campus is of an unacceptable substandard level compared to the mainstream secondary schools in our local area. Our students have been discriminated against and treated like second class citizens. How would you feel if your child wasn't afforded the same resources and opportunities as their peers? Many of us have other children in secondary mainstream settings, we have conducted research comparing local schools to Northern School for Autism.
Here is a list of our staggering results.
Our current deficits:
- no green spaces
- no areas to play outdoor sport
- no library
- no gym
- no science/stem room
- no music/drama/performance spaces
- No classroom for Food Technology/health Lessons (kitchen)
- no room to conduct speech/occupational therapy sessions
- no art room and more.
The 2021 Budget has excluded our students at Northern School for Autism, Lalor Campus, allocating NO funds! Our students only have a set of drawings for future planning! Every secondary school in the local area have received a commitment of funds. Why didn't Northern School for Autism, Lalor campus receive funds?
